Flinching
A behaviour edit that allows the player and NPC's to flinch when they're hit by melee weapons, flinching doesn't override a state that an actor
is in, it plays over the top of normal animations via blends





Video from the SSE version


It's not a perfect system as it uses scripts to find when an actor gets hit, it also uses a restarting quest system(like in Animated Armoury) to find npcs around the player, so there are times when NPCs can't be flinched but this time is short

Player and NPCs can not re flinch until they finished flinching, 1.3 added in support for Draugrs as well as allowing players and NPCs to be
flinched in nearly all states

You can edit two global variables in the console to change weather the NPCs or the Player can flinch, they're both defaulted to on

"set NPCcanFlinch to 0"
"set PlyrcanFlinch to 0"

Installing/Uninstalling
Steps for Installing
1) Download and install this mod
2) Download and install Nemesis(Off Site Link)
3) Tick "Flinching Animations" in the list of patches
4) Run Nemesis and click "Update Engine" wait for that to finish then click on "Launch Nemesis Behavior Engine" wait for that to finish
5) You can now play the game, no need for a new save

Steps for Uninstalling
1) Go to an inside cell, make sure no one is getting hit, type "set NPCcanFlinch to 0" then "set PlyrcanFlinch to 0" into the console and wait a sec
2) Save the close the game
3) Uninstall in your preferred mod manager
4) Run Nemesis and click "Update Engine" wait for that to finish then click on "Launch Nemesis Behavior Engine" wait for that to finish
5) You have now uninstalled the mod


Compatibility

There's a patch for Ultimate Combat and draugr's, it's in the Fomod installer, it will overwrite one of Ultimate combat's files
CGO and 360 movement behaviour both work with this
Should be compatible with SkySA
Animated Armoury now has built in support for flinching, you need to tick the DAR option in AA's MCM menu or use the pure DAR version of AA

NOT Compatible with FNIS
